A power surge, which is also called transient voltage, is basically an increase in voltage that's above the normal level of electricity flow. While a surge will not necessarily severely damage or destroy a piece of equipment right on the spot, it can peck on it for a very long time and eventually cause problems serious enough for you to notice. The farther your lights are from this transformer, the dimmer they are going to be. An extra or bigger transformer can address this, but many homeowners also opt for the ‘natural' look of lights being brighter the closer they are to the actual home.
